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Vim versions prior to 9.0.0101
Description
The issue is related to a heap-based buffer overflow in the vim iswordp buf function of the Vim text editor. This allows an attacker to access confidential data, compromise its integrity, and potentially cause a denial of service using a specially crafted file.
Recommendations
For versions prior to 9.0.0101, update to version 9.0.0101 or later to resolve the issue. As a temporary workaround, consider restricting the use of the vim iswordp buf function until a patch is available.
